Make _submit_bh() handle refcounting by increasing bio->bi_remaining,
followed by bio_endio(). Since bio chaining was introduced with
196d38bccfcf ("block: Generic bio chaining"), refcounting should be
done on bi_remaining instead of ancient bio_cnt. Doing that, calling
convention can be consistent with the immutable biovecs API.

diff --git a/fs/buffer.c b/fs/buffer.c
index c7a5602..c1c0e0d 100644
--- a/fs/buffer.c
+++ b/fs/buffer.c
@@ -3041,13 +3041,13 @@ int _submit_bh(int rw, struct buffer_head *bh, unsigned 
long bio_flags)
        if (buffer_prio(bh))
                rw |= REQ_PRIO;
 
-       bio_get(bio);
+       bio_inc_remaining(bio);
        submit_bio(rw, bio);
 
        if (bio_flagged(bio, BIO_EOPNOTSUPP))
                ret = -EOPNOTSUPP;
 
-       bio_put(bio);
+       bio_endio(bio, 0);
        return ret;
 }
 EXPORT_SYMBOL_GPL(_submit_bh);
